Love is the energizing elixir of the Universe, the cause and effect of all Harmony.
Interpretation
Love is a powerful force that brings balance and joy to the universe.
This quote by Rumi suggests that love is not just an emotion but a vital energy that drives the universe and creates harmony. It implies that love is fundamental to our existence and impacts every relationship and interaction, suggesting that all positive outcomes stem from acts of love and connection.
